S.R. Troelstra is a scholar working on Atmospheric Science, Ecology and Earth-Surface Processes. According to data from OpenAlex, S.R. Troelstra has authored 86 papers receiving a total of 3.1k indexed citations (citations by other indexed papers that have themselves been cited), including 68 papers in Atmospheric Science, 33 papers in Ecology and 24 papers in Earth-Surface Processes. Recurrent topics in S.R. Troelstra's work include Geology and Paleoclimatology Research (68 papers), Geological formations and processes (24 papers) and Isotope Analysis in Ecology (23 papers). S.R. Troelstra is often cited by papers focused on Geology and Paleoclimatology Research (68 papers), Geological formations and processes (24 papers) and Isotope Analysis in Ecology (23 papers). S.R. Troelstra collaborates with scholars based in Netherlands, United Kingdom and Denmark. S.R. Troelstra's co-authors include Sacha de Rijk, Antoon Kuijpers, Maarten A. Prins, Eelco J. Rohling, Willem Renema, J H Fred Jansen, Frans Jorissen, Christiaan J. Beets, Dick Kroon and Gerald Ganssen and has published in prestigious journals such as Nature, Science and Geochimica et Cosmochimica Acta.
